Healthcare OPT Jobs in Alabama
Healthcare F-1 OPT sponsorship jobs in Alabama are concentrated around major medical systems including UAB Medicine in Birmingham, Huntsville Hospital, and Mobile Infirmary. The state's growing academic medical centers and rural health initiatives create openings for international students in clinical, research, and health sciences roles across Birmingham, Huntsville, and Mobile.

Works with patients who have impairments, limitations, disabilities, or changes in physical function and health status resulting from injury, disease or other causes. The Physical Therapist role includes examination, evaluation, diagnosis, prognosis and interventions toward achieving the highest functional outcomes for each patient or client.
Responsibilities:
Essential Functions
- Evaluates patients, gathering data from the patient, the physician, interdisciplinary team meetings if available, family and significant other persons and data sources.
- Develops treatment plans which integrate with the continuum of care and have specific goals and objectives and treats accordingly.
- Demonstrates competency in the use, care and maintenance of profession specific equipment, observing safety precautions and providing verbal explanations of the equipment and its purpose.
- Demonstrates knowledge and skills necessary to treat and provide care appropriate to the age of the patients served on the assigned caseload.
- Re-evaluates and modifies treatment plan and goals when appropriate.
- Demonstrates knowledge of the principles of growth and development over the life span.
- Assesses data reflective of the patient’s status and interprets the appropriate information needed to identify each patient’s requirements relative to his or her age-specific needs.
- Provides care as described in the unit’s/area’s/department’s policies and procedures.
- Demonstrates the knowledge and skills necessary to provide care appropriate to the age of the patients served on his or her practicing location(s). Recognizes and communicates when the patient has received optimal benefit from physical therapy.
- Adheres to State Practice Act and Standards of Practice.
- Ensures complete documentation and accurate billing.
- Provides patient/family education as indicated.
- Maintains reasonably regular, punctual attendance consistent with Orlando Health policies, the ADA, FMLA and other federal, state and local standards.
- Maintains compliance with all Orlando Health policies and procedures.
Other Related Functions
- Maintains a positive and encouraging treatment environment.
- Demonstrates caring, honesty, and open communication with all patients and coworkers.
- Maintains a professional appearance.
- Participates in Performance Improvement, program development, student supervision, assigned committees, safety, and infection control, as required.
- Demonstrates an awareness of legal issues, patient rights, and compliance with regulatory and accrediting agencies.
- Practices efficient use and selection of supplies and equipment.
- Instructs and supervises supportive personnel in their duties.
Qualifications:
Education/Training
Bachelor’s degree or higher from an approved program in physical therapy.
Licensure/Certification
- Maintains current Physical Therapist license in the State of Alabama. Temporary permit acceptable.
- Maintains current BLS/HealthCare Provider certification.
Experience
None.

Which healthcare companies sponsor F-1 OPT visas in Alabama?
UAB Medicine and the University of Alabama at Birmingham Health System are among the most active F-1 OPT sponsors in the state, particularly for research and clinical support roles. Huntsville Hospital, Ascension St. Vincent's, and Children's of Alabama have also hired international students on OPT. Academic medical centers affiliated with universities tend to have more established OPT onboarding processes than smaller private practices.
Which cities in Alabama have the most healthcare F-1 OPT sponsorship jobs?
Birmingham accounts for the largest share of healthcare F-1 OPT opportunities in Alabama, driven by UAB's medical campus and the broader hospital network concentrated there. Huntsville is a secondary hub with a growing healthcare sector tied to its research economy. Mobile supports additional openings through Infirmary Health and USA Health, the clinical arm of the University of South Alabama.
What types of healthcare roles typically qualify for F-1 OPT sponsorship in Alabama?
Roles that align directly with a student's field of study are the strongest fit. Clinical research coordinators, health informatics analysts, biomedical engineers, public health associates, and laboratory technicians are common OPT-eligible positions at Alabama healthcare institutions. For STEM OPT extension eligibility, roles in health data analytics, biomedical research, and clinical informatics are particularly well-suited since they fall under STEM-designated degree programs.

Are there any Alabama-specific considerations for F-1 OPT sponsorship in healthcare?
Alabama has a higher proportion of rural and community health settings compared to coastal states, and smaller facilities in those areas are less likely to have experience sponsoring OPT students. Focusing on Birmingham's academic medical corridor or institutions affiliated with Alabama's public universities increases the likelihood of working with HR teams familiar with OPT authorization requirements. Students pursuing STEM OPT extensions should confirm their specific role and employer qualify before accepting an offer.
